For the quarter ended December 2020, SBI has posted a net profit of Rs 52 bn (down 6.9% YoY). Sales on the other hand came in at Rs 667 bn (down 1.4% YoY). Read on for a complete analysis of SBI's quarterly results.
For the quarter ended September 2020, SBI has posted a net profit of Rs 46 bn (up 51.9% YoY). Sales on the other hand came in at Rs 668 bn (up 3.9% YoY). Read on for a complete analysis of SBI's quarterly results.
